Kicad-ngspice: Unterschied zwischen den Versionen
(neu) |
|||
| Zeile 1: | Zeile 1: | ||
= Hinweise zur ngspice Integration = | = Hinweise zur ngspice Integration in KiCad = | ||
* Bei Winderständen >= 1M aufpassen, das ngspice die richtigen Werte enthält, da standardmäßig M für milli steht. Dazu entweder bei Eigenschaften->Spice-Modell die Einheit '''Meg''' verwenden oder sicherstellen das im Spice-Simulator unter Benutzerdefiniert '''Passive Bauteilwerte anpassen' aktiviert ist. | * Bei Winderständen >= 1M aufpassen, das ngspice die richtigen Werte enthält, da standardmäßig M für milli steht. Dazu entweder bei Eigenschaften->Spice-Modell die Einheit '''Meg''' verwenden oder sicherstellen das im Spice-Simulator unter Benutzerdefiniert '''Passive Bauteilwerte anpassen' aktiviert ist. | ||
* Bei Tumbleweed wird automtisch GND als 0-Netz verwendet. Falls das nicht gewünscht wird , kann '''set no_auto_gnd''' gesetzt werden. Siehe dazu [http://ngspice.sourceforge.net/docs/ngspice-36-manual.pdf ngspice user manual - chapter 2.1.4 Some naming conventions] ''For compatibility reason gnd is accepted as ground node, and will internally be treated as a global node and be converted to ‘0’. If this is not feasible, you may switch the conversion off by setting set no_auto_gnd in one of the configuration files spinit or .spiceinit.'' | * Bei Tumbleweed wird automtisch GND als 0-Netz verwendet. Falls das nicht gewünscht wird , kann '''set no_auto_gnd''' gesetzt werden. Siehe dazu [http://ngspice.sourceforge.net/docs/ngspice-36-manual.pdf ngspice user manual - chapter 2.1.4 Some naming conventions] ''For compatibility reason gnd is accepted as ground node, and will internally be treated as a global node and be converted to ‘0’. If this is not feasible, you may switch the conversion off by setting set no_auto_gnd in one of the configuration files spinit or .spiceinit.'' | ||
* Die Pinanordnung bei Dioden, Transistoren und IC's bei Kicad passt in der Regel nicht mit ngspice überein und kann unter '''Eigenschaften->Spice-Modell->Alternative Knotensequenz''' angepasst werden. Achtung: Checkbox vor dem angezeigten Text aktivieren | * Die Pinanordnung bei Dioden, Transistoren und IC's bei Kicad passt in der Regel nicht mit ngspice überein und kann unter '''Eigenschaften->Spice-Modell->Alternative Knotensequenz''' angepasst werden. Achtung: Checkbox vor dem angezeigten Text aktivieren | ||
Version vom 11. Mai 2022, 21:27 Uhr
Hinweise zur ngspice Integration in KiCad
- Bei Winderständen >= 1M aufpassen, das ngspice die richtigen Werte enthält, da standardmäßig M für milli steht. Dazu entweder bei Eigenschaften->Spice-Modell die Einheit Meg verwenden oder sicherstellen das im Spice-Simulator unter Benutzerdefiniert Passive Bauteilwerte anpassen' aktiviert ist.
- Bei Tumbleweed wird automtisch GND als 0-Netz verwendet. Falls das nicht gewünscht wird , kann set no_auto_gnd gesetzt werden. Siehe dazu ngspice user manual - chapter 2.1.4 Some naming conventions For compatibility reason gnd is accepted as ground node, and will internally be treated as a global node and be converted to ‘0’. If this is not feasible, you may switch the conversion off by setting set no_auto_gnd in one of the configuration files spinit or .spiceinit.
- Die Pinanordnung bei Dioden, Transistoren und IC's bei Kicad passt in der Regel nicht mit ngspice überein und kann unter Eigenschaften->Spice-Modell->Alternative Knotensequenz angepasst werden. Achtung: Checkbox vor dem angezeigten Text aktivieren